What should I send in with my radar unit?
It's best to send a complete unit whenever possible. This would include all cables, antennas, display boxes, counting units, etc.  This removes the possiblity that your repair will be delayed by us needing a part not sent.  Sometimes the problem does not origniate in the part in which it seems to manifest from.
We do not need the Tuning Forks for your radar unit unless you are specifically requesting that they be calibrated / certified
